From WordNet (r) 3.0 (2006) [wn]:
hurricane
n
  1. a severe tropical cyclone usually with heavy rains and winds moving a 73-136 knots (12 on the Beaufort scale)
From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913) [web1913]:
   Hurricane \Hur"ri*cane\, n. [Sp. hurracan; orig. a Carib word
      signifying, a high wind.]
      A violent storm, characterized by extreme fury and sudden
      changes of the wind, and generally accompanied by rain,
      thunder, and lightning; -- especially prevalent in the East
      and West Indies. Also used figuratively.
  
               Like the smoke in a hurricane whirl'd.   --Tennyson.
  
               Each guilty thought to me is A dreadful hurricane.
                                                                              --Massinger.
  
      {Hurricane bird} (Zo[94]l.), the frigate bird.
  
      {Hurricane deck}. (Naut.) See under {Deck}.

From U.S. Gazetteer (1990) [gazetteer]:
   Hurricane, UT (city, FIPS 37170)
      Location: 37.15990 N, 113.33919 W
      Population (1990): 3915 (1325 housing units)
      Area: 57.2 sq km (land), 0.0 sq km (water)
      Zip code(s): 84737
   Hurricane, WV (city, FIPS 39532)
      Location: 38.43681 N, 82.01694 W
      Population (1990): 4461 (1831 housing units)
      Area: 6.4 sq km (land), 0.1 sq km (water)
      Zip code(s): 25526
